Animal Appaloosa Equine - High resolution null wallpaper (3877x5814)

Animal Appaloosa Equine

Download Options

Details

Resolution3877×5814
CategoryN/A
Sourcepixabay
Likes36
Downloads1,419

Author

JosepMonter
View Profile